Environmental protection and maritime heritage initiatives in Rome and Rimini
In Rome, the Nucleo Ispettori Forestali, led by Commander Angelo Scatolini, is intensifying efforts to protect the capital's natural heritage. Key activities include fire prevention in urban parks and nature reserves, combating environmental crimes such as illegal waste dumping, protecting wildlife from poaching, and conducting environmental education programs in local schools.
In Rimini, the Rimini Blue Lab is participating in the Festa de’ Borga San Giuliano as part of the 'Rimini di verde e di blu' sustainable urban development strategy. The initiative focuses on coastal resilience and maritime heritage through cultural activities, including a performance by Gianluca Reggiani and a documentary exhibition by local students. These efforts are part of a long-term project to enhance urban and coastal naturalization, supported by European funds.
